Just returned from my diving holidays. Lanzarote is a tiny little island off the west coast of Africa just besides Morraco. Very popular holiday destination among western europeans.
Its an amazing island for its volcanic landscape. The hole island is black from the past multiple erruptions from 3 major volcanoes. No greens what so ever except palm trees and cactus even though its not a desert.
It belongs to Spain from its colonial past. Lanzarote is one of the 5 small islands of Canary islands.
Cactus and palms are the commen trees and shrubs.
Beautiful beech scene. lanzorote is full of long, sun drenched, sumptous beeches. What difference.
The inland is noting but one burntout lava flow, mile and miles of black churned out earth bereft of any vegitation what so ever. So much violence and distruction fit for a big continent but in a small island.
